What measuring in performance marketing means
The first step is to understand what is performance marketing. It is a marketing model in which brands pay only for measurable results. These results can be sales, leads, clicks, or other concrete actions, making the process more predictable and easier to control.
When it comes to digital performance marketing, the tools used are varied. They can include search engine campaigns, social media ads, email marketing, or even influencer promotion. Each channel provides clear data that can be tracked in real-time and compared with the brand’s initial objectives.
Here are some examples of metrics used in campaigns:
- Cost per acquisition (CPA)
- Conversion rate (CR)
- Average order value (AOV)
- Number of leads generated
- Customer retention rate
- Cost per lead
- Click-through rate (CTR)

Performance Max for retail aims primarily to increase sales both online and in-store. The strategy uses all Google networks – Search, Display, YouTube, and Discover – to reach customers at different stages of the buying process. This allows retailers to achieve more sales, higher order values, and use budgets more efficiently through automated bidding and targeting the right audience.

The best tools for analyzing marketing performance include Google Analytics 4, which provides detailed data on traffic and user behavior; Google Data Studio, for visualizing and comparing data; SEMrush, for analyzing competition and SEO performance; HubSpot, for managing campaigns and leads; and Tableau, for creating interactive dashboards and advanced reporting. These tools help understand campaign results and make informed decisions to optimize performance.

The differences between performance marketing vs digital marketing are clear. The first focuses on direct, measurable results, while the second includes awareness or branding campaigns, where measurement is more complex and not always immediate.
